Decentralized Finance: Exploring the Future of Money
Decentralized finance, or DeFi, transforms the traditional financial landscape. Powered by blockchain technology, DeFi offers a transparent and robust platform for financial services.
From lending and borrowing to trading and staking, DeFi enables individuals to manage their finances directly, reducing the need for intermediaries. This revolution has the potential to level the playing field financial products and foster greater financial inclusion.
As DeFi continues to evolve, it stands ready to reimagine the future of money.
